Owned for less than 1 week when reviewed.This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.After purchasing an eero system for our home we purchased this single unit for our houseboat. We have a 46' houseboat and our WiFi coverage was terrible with the gateway unit supplied by our internet provider. We use the eero as our router. It has not only given us excellent coverage throughout the boat but also 150' to the end of our dock! We're very satisfied.

||Posted . Owned for 3 weeks when reviewed.This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.Phenomenal. Basically, this thing outperforms the Eero Pro Wifi 5 version, which is amazing given this is the normal variant of the Wifi 6 Eero. This thing tops out around 550mb/sec, where the Eero Pro 6 gets you about 725mb/sec. So it's plenty fast for just about everyone. Not a single glitch, issue, or complaint. May not be the absolute fastest out there, but it's rock solid reliable.

Posted .Hi Janelle. Thank you for providing feedback about your experience with the eero 6 router. I know hoe frustrating it is when a new device doesn't perform as expected. eero uses a single SSID that combines the 2.4 Ghz and 5 Ghz bands. The Blink sync module and other devices that only operate on the 2.4 GHz band may need an extra step to get them up and running. You can use the eero app to temporarily hide the 5 GHz band while you get your 2.4 GHz devices connected. Open the eero app and tap “Settings” at the bottom of the home screen. Tap “troubleshooting” towards the bottom of the settings screen. Tap ”My device won’t connect.” Tap “Temporarily pause 5 GHz. This will pause the 5 GHz band for 15 minutes while you get your 2.4 GHz devices setup. If this doesn’t resolve the issue, please reach out directly to eero customer support at (877) 659-2347.
